Output 64d91d72729a86e43a7463fc13a4599a73c0ec01177c81dfb50e608214ce55b4:4

value
23596928
script pubkey
OP_0 OP_PUSHBYTES_20 a1f61a2f4bebcd91e73d7499f5170fb2ce72e346
address
ltc1q58mp5t6ta0xereeawjvl29c0kt889c6xeshwdt
transaction
64d91d72729a86e43a7463fc13a4599a73c0ec01177c81dfb50e608214ce55b4
spent
true